In the previous 5 years, 37% of respondents had actually encountered bed bugs, while in the past 10 years, just 21% had actually encountered bed insects. 2 According to data from Terminix, the most bed buginfested united state cities in 2012 were Philadelphia, Cincinnati, and New York City. 3 This recent resurgence may be attributed to raised prices of international travel, migration, changes in insect control methods, and insecticide resistance.4 Threat variables for bed bug problems consist of fast turnover of homeowners, boosted population density, and constant moving. Unsanitary problems and the number of individuals in a house are not the most effective signs for the existence of bed pests, and break outs are typically not specific to any type of geographical areas or climate problems.
A woman will certainly lay roughly 200 to 500 eggs during her lifetime, and the typical life-span has to do with 10 months. 6 Bed insects are primarily nighttime, and they have a tendency to hide during the day. Their little, flat bodies are suitable for concealing in crevices in mattresses, box springtimes, bed frameworks, and headboards.

5 Bed insects can spread out by either active or easy dispersal. Energetic dispersal happens when a bed bug uses its legs to walk a short range to a new place.
A bed bug might spread in between rooms in plagued buildings this means. Passive dispersal is when a bed bug is transferred on apparel, luggage, furniture, and other items.

Bed bug invasion should be suspected if dark brown or reddish brownish fecal and blood places are found on clothes, cushions, bed linens, or furnishings. Furthermore, bed pests can give off a particular sweet, stuffy scent. Clients may present with itching or skin irritation with bed bug attacks, yet not every person has a reaction to the bites.
Bed insect problem is confirmed by the existence of real-time or dead bugs or their eggs. Every fracture and gap in living areas must be browsed extensively to validate the visibility of bed bugs. Using a flashlight about an hour prior to dawn is an excellent way to find bed bugs because they are extra active throughout that time.

It is most commonly estimated that 20% of individuals will not react to bed bug attacks. 9 However, a current research figured out that 11 out of 24 people experienced no reaction to a very first bite and that 18 out of 19 people created a response upon subsequent bites. 9 This suggests that hosts can end up being animated after repeated exposure.
10 They go to this site may appear in an arbitrary development or in a straight line, and the number of bites typically relies on the extent of the problem. 11 Cutaneous responses from bed bug attacks can vary greatly. Normally, bites present as erythematous and maculopapular skin sores that have to do with 2 to 5 mm in size.

The bites usually look very similar to a mosquito or flea bite and are linked with itching and inflammation. Extra intricate skin responses might provide as regional urticaria and bullous rashes.
These reactions include generalised urticaria, bronchial asthma, and, in extremely rare situations, anaphylaxis. The blood loss a host experiences during a bite usually does not negatively influence the host. 6 Nevertheless, there have been rare records of iron shortage anemia with extreme problems. 10 Psychological wellness issues such as anxiety and sleeping disorders have actually additionally been reported in people living in bed buginfested homes.

More examinations are necessary to identify if bed pests play a duty in illness transmission. Bed pests are extremely tough to eliminate.
Oftentimes numerous rounds of physical and chemical removal will be required to eradicate bed pests from an infested site.: Removal and disposal of plagued furnishings and mattresses may be necessary if the infestation is severe - https://issuu.com/bedbugextrd1s. For less serious invasions, bed insects can be eliminated with vacuuming. It is usually needed to scrape bed pests with the suction end of the vacuum to eliminate them

Vacuuming ought to be executed everyday or every various other day until the infestation is gone. The vacuum cleaner bag should be removed, correctly sealed in an additional bag, and put in an outdoors dumpster (AwesomePest bed bug treatment dallas bed bugs). As soon as a vacuum cleaner is made use of for elimination of bed insects, it ought to only be used for that objective

Steam cleaning might not be as reliable as vacuuming because the warm might not reach well-hidden bed pests (https://hearthis.at/jay-teran/set/bed-bug-exterminator-dallas/). Sheets, drapes, clothing, and other washable products need to be washed in hot soapy water and dried for a minimum of 20 mins in a warm clothes dryer. This must eliminate the majority of bed pests and their eggs
